Steel grinding balls high chrome balls are widely used in many industries, including mining, cement, chemical, and power generation. These grinding balls are made from high-quality steel alloys that are designed to withstand wear and tear, making them ideal for use in harsh environments. However, in order to maximize the durability and performance of these balls, it is important to subject them to certain heat treatment processes, such as tempering or annealing. One such process is the process of annealing, also known as "tempering".

 

The purpose of annealing is to reduce the hardness of the grinding balls, making them less likely to break or crack under stress. This is achieved by heating the balls to a specific temperature and holding them at that temperature for a certain period of time. The exact temperature and duration of annealing will vary depending on the specific properties of the steel alloy being used. Generally speaking, the balls are heated to a temperature of around 600-700 degrees Celsius and held at this temperature for several hours.

Once the annealing process is complete, the forged steel grinding balls are allowed to cool slowly in order to prevent any cracks or distortion from forming. The result is a set of steel balls that are tougher, more ductile, and less brittle than before. They will be less likely to break or deform under stress, making them ideal for use in high-stress environments such as grinding mills or crushers.

 

Overall, the purpose of annealing or tempering grinding cast high chrome ballis to enhance their overall performance and durability, making them more effective and reliable in industrial applications. Without these heat treatment processes, steel balls would be more prone to breaking or wearing out prematurely, leading to increased maintenance costs and downtime for businesses.
